So four weeks to release date guys! It seems their main competition in the charts will be Diana Vickers, who'll be releasing 'The Boy Who Murdered Love' on the same day as them. It's kind of cute that Adam Lambert is also releasing his new single in the UK on the 19th. That's pretty much it for that week but there are quite a few farirly high profile new releases in the previous fortnight ; Kesha, JLS, Lee Ryan and Kelis on the 5th and then Esmee Denters/JT, Mark Ronson, Prof Green, Scouting for Girls and MIA all on the 12th. Alejandro will still probably be selling bucketloads, even though it's released on the 28 of June, same story for Kylie. Overall, they picked a very good week. The competition is much tougher in late June/early July. I think Diana has already been c-listed by Radio 1 and they're playing it quite a bit. It probably won't be as radio friendly as ATST but she'll get the usual giant push from Rad 1 who are in love with her. ATST really needs to start getting some airplay in the uk from next week and ideally we should see the video on all the channels from next week too. I think Universal are leaving everything too late for the uk release... Anyway, anyone like to put their head on the block and predict a chart position?
